On Thursday night Hailey started acting like she was getting a cold. Since she is over 2 and my RSV fears are subsiding we are fully enjoying all the fall activities and not letting a little cold scare us. So I was prepared for a "little" cold. Well, leave it to Hailey not to get a little cold, but full-blown croup. It came on fast and hard. She woke up Thursday early morning (around 3am) breathing really hard (it sounded like she was hyperventilating), probably scared herself. You can hear rattling in her chest/throat with every breathe she takes. I am learning not to overreact myself and thankfully Tim was home that night so we just got her to calm down and she slept with us until we could go to the doctors the next day. They ended up giving her a shot of steriods since she was breathing so hard and told us the croup should last 3-4 days and then turn into a regular cold. Doctors solution for coughing fits or breathing difficulties, take her in the cold air even at 2am. So yesterday we took her outside a couple of times and opened all the windows to let that cold air in.


Today she seems to be the same, though thankfully her breathing seems to have improved a little. So we are off to a good start this winter and really "winter" hasn't even arrived yet :-)
